How they compare

Norway currently reports 123.35 1000 USD against 105.5 1000 USD in Dominican Republic, a difference of 17.85 1000 USD.

That makes Norway's figure about 1.2 times Dominican Republic's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 16 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Norway ahead.

Dominican Republic ranks 87th and Norway ranks 84th of 173 countries.

Dominican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
